Either Camellia or Ember can provide the Evil Eye (the effect takes place for 1 round even if they save). Alternatively, a fighter with weapons training or ranger with favored enemy can help with AB too. If you're not a Paladin Seelah or even Regill should be able to smite. In the picture, I didn't actually have all my available buffs, but it was more than enough to get into "hit" range. Use Greater Magic Weapon to make it a +5. Finnean in his +3 form is insanely useful since Brilliant Energy is effectively +9 to hit. Truesight is also a must (since you're already contending against high AC). You just need to stack enough buffs and debuffs. I'm not sure what your mythic path is, so you might need some alternativesĮven if you don't have some fancy mythic spell, his AC is high, but not literally unhittable. I'll break this up into two parts - damaging him, and surviving him. Nothing super fancy in terms of tricks, just getting in a few buffs and a few tactics. So here's my experience dealing with him (on Core, with a Paladin/Angel).
